What's The Definition Of Accurate?
accurate
adjective: Accurate information, measurements, and statistics are correct to a very detailed level. An accurate instrument is able to give you information of this kind. adjective: An accurate statement or account gives a true or fair judgment of something. accurate in American English careful and exact adjective: free from error or defect; consistent with a standard, rule, or model; precise; exact accurate in British English adjective: faithfully representing or describing the truth |
